You deserved it: Juan Mata thank fans after first trophy with United

The Manchester United playmaker is still basking in the euphoria of United's FA Cup triumph on Saturday.

The Spanish international scored United's equalizer that pushed the game to extra time.

United were the best team for most of the games, buy fell behind to a Puncheon's goal late into the second half. Inspirational Wayne Rooney rose to the occasion with an powerful run around the Palace's defence to cross the ball for Fellaini and Mata to combine for United's equalizer. Mata wrote on his Kicca blog:

My first trophy with United, finally! It took quite a few years for the club to win the FA Cup again, that special and unique tournament, and last Saturday we made it...

Being able to win this Cup for you, after your unconditional support throughout the entire season, makes me feel absolutely happy and proud. You deserved it, for sure. The road to the final wasn't easy at all.

And the same can be said about the game against Crystal Palace: it was thrilling, like a big final is meant to be. For everyone familiar with English football, I'm not revealing any secret by saying that this competition is different, genuine, and so it is the final at Wembley, with its amazing atmosphere. We saw it just a couple of days ago.

The FA Cup final is an unforgettable experience: the organisation, the pre-match show, the tension during the game... Luckily for me, I have been involved in two and both of them ended up with me lifting the trophy. I feel privileged for that.
